Hi everyone,
 
My first interstate trip as Australian Children’s Laureate was this month to South Australia. Regional areas in Australia are important to me because children there often don’t have the same opportunity to hear a visiting children’s author or illustrator as do students in the major cities. I had great fun book talking, reading, and drawing dragons with students at Stirling Library in the Adelaide Hills and at Kingscote, Parndana and Penneshaw campuses on Kangaroo Island. I also presented to a group of adults at the Hahndorf Academy.
 
My next trip will be to the Museum of Art and Culture at Lake Macquarie in NSW during Book Week, where I’ll be talking about the importance of imagination to even more children.

FOLLOW THE DRAGON TOUR

CBCA 2022 Book Week is coming up in August, and we are excited to be sending Gabrielle to the Museum of Art and Culture in Lake Macquarie NSW for a very special workshop event. She will be speaking with children from local schools and exploring ideas about where stories come from and the important role of art.
 
Gabrielle will also share more about her Laureate mission “Imagine A Story” with local members of the Newcastle Sub-Branch of the CBCA NSW Branch.

Laureates Online

 
Available Now
 
Laureates Online is a fantastic new offering from the Australian Children’s Laureate Foundation featuring our wonderfully talented Laureates.
 
Ursula Dubosarsky talks about Show Don't Tell, Write What You Know and Writing the First Draft, while Alison Lester shows you How to Create a Picture Book step by step. 
 
The presentations are free to schools with 100 students or less or with an ICSEA rating below 1000. Other schools will be charged a small fee with all funds going to support the Laureate Program.
